SWIFTUVOT Field Descriptions

You may submit queries using any of the fields listed below. The "Column label" is the name displayed on the search forms and in search results. The "Column name" is the actual column name in the table and needs to be specified in GET requests. (See the MAST Services web page for information on submitting GET requests.) If the "Column name" is in italics, it means the table is indexed on that field and queries with that field will run faster. Clicking on "Data Type" entries will display information on search options.

When using the "user-specified field" form element on a MAST search form, simply select the column "label" in the forms pulldown menu and type in the qualification in the adjacent box. If you specify constraints on the same column in more than one form element, they will all be included in the query and you may not get results you expect. Note the entries in the table below may be sorted by clicking on the column headings.

Catalog Description of Swift UVOT Observations Table
Last Update: September 10, 2012

swo_obs_id Obs ID Observation ID: First 8 characters are the same as the target ID. The last three characters indicate the observation. 11 character name; e.g. 00035028075, 00041868001 string
swo_targ_id Target ID Target ID is the first 8 characters of the obs_id e.g., 0036557 string
swo_object Target Name Target Name e.g. PKS1830-211, GRB101213a, SN2010jr, Comet103P/Hartley2 string
swo_ra_pnt RA (J2000) Right Ascension (J2000) range -90 to 360 deg ra
swo_dec_pnt Dec (J2000) Declination (J2000) range -90 to +90 deg dec
swo_pa_pnt Position Angle Position Angle range -90 to 360 deg float
swo_date_obs Start Time Start Time for the first exposure of the observation/filter set for this observation Dec 17 2004 23:09:57 to present datetime
swo_date_end Stop Time Stop Time for the last exposure of the observation/filter set for this observation Dec 17 2004 23:11:37 to present datetime
swo_exptime Exp Time Exposure time (summed for all exposures in the observation/filter set) range: 0.00 - 65,868.9 seconds float
swo_num_exp Number of Exp. Number of exposures range: currently 1 to 132 integer
swo_filter Filter Filter used B, BLOCKED, MAGNIFIER, U, UGRISM, UNKNOWN, UVM2, UVW1, UVW2, V, VGRISM, WHITE string
